From 9e73f2569021b0399e5fe67c3fd95bb44d800a3e Mon Sep 17 00:00:00 2001
From: wxr <464027401@qq.com>
Date: 星期三, 01 二月 2023 11:16:35 +0800
Subject: [PATCH] Merge branch 'wxr' of http://172.16.1.23:6688/r/~wxr/CrabtreeOn into wxr

---
 Crabtree/SmartHome/UI/SimpleControl/Phone/Register/MigrationServer.cs |   36 ++++++++++++++++++++++++++++--------
 1 files changed, 28 insertions(+), 8 deletions(-)

diff --git a/Crabtree/SmartHome/UI/SimpleControl/Phone/Register/MigrationServer.cs b/Crabtree/SmartHome/UI/SimpleControl/Phone/Register/MigrationServer.cs
index e92f561..a5d14d8 100644
--- a/Crabtree/SmartHome/UI/SimpleControl/Phone/Register/MigrationServer.cs
+++ b/Crabtree/SmartHome/UI/SimpleControl/Phone/Register/MigrationServer.cs
@@ -435,7 +435,7 @@
                             continue;
                         }
                     }
-                }
+                }
             }
             if (!dic.ContainsKey ("list")) {
                 dic.Add ("list", fileObjs);
@@ -534,8 +534,8 @@
                                 continue;
                             }
                         }
-                    }
-                }
+                    }
+                }
             }
             if (!dic.ContainsKey ("list")) {
                 dic.Add ("list", fileObjs);
@@ -551,6 +551,24 @@
         }
 
 
+
+        /// 杩佺Щ鏈嶅姟鍣ㄥ叏閮ㄥ浠�
+        /// </summary>
+        private void MoveCloudBackup ()
+        {
+            var dic = new Dictionary<string, object> ();
+            dic.Add ("oldPlatformToken", MainPage.LoginUser.LoginTokenString);//鏃у钩鍙皌oken
+            dic.Add ("oldPlatformHomeId", UserConfig.Instance.CurrentRegion.RegionID);//鏃у钩鍙颁綇瀹卛d
+            dic.Add ("homeId", newUserId);//鏂板钩鍙颁綇瀹卛d
+            dic.Add ("userId", newUserId);//鏂板钩鍙扮敤鎴穒d
+            dic.Add ("tenantId", "202106");//绉熸埛id
+            var requestJson = HttpUtil.GetSignRequestJson (dic);
+            var revertObj = MainPage.RequestHttps ("/home-wisdom/data/move/backup/all", requestJson, false, false, SeverAddr);
+            if (revertObj != null) {
+                if (revertObj.code == "0") {
+                }
+            }
+        }
 
         /// <summary>
         /// 鑾峰彇瀹氭椂鍣ㄥ垪琛�
@@ -930,16 +948,18 @@
                                 var backId = moveFolder2New (newHomeId);
                                 //杩佺Щ澶囦唤鏂囦欢
                                 var moveFileResult = MoveFile2New (backId);
-                                Application.RunOnMainThread (() => {
-                                    btnTipMsg.Text = "Migrating server backup.";
-                                    btnTipMsg.TextColor = SkinStyle.Current.TextColor;
-                                });
-                                MoveOldBackupList ();
+                                // Application.RunOnMainThread (() => {
+                                //     btnTipMsg.Text = "Migrating server backup.";
+                                //     btnTipMsg.TextColor = SkinStyle.Current.TextColor;
+                                // });
+                                // MoveOldBackupList ();
                                 if (moveFileResult == "true") {
                                     Application.RunOnMainThread (() => {
                                         btnTipMsg.Text = "Migration backup succeeded, migrating Schedule data.";
                                         btnTipMsg.TextColor = SkinStyle.Current.TextColor;
                                     });
+                                    //杩佺Щ浜戠鍏朵粬澶囦唤
+                                    MoveCloudBackup ();
                                     //杩佺Щ瀹氭椂鍣�
                                     var timerList = GetTimer (newHomeId);
                                     if (timerList == null) {

--
Gitblit v1.8.0